Breaking Down the €25,000 Price Tag

That €25,000 figure is no anomaly. Many single women face similar or even higher bills by the time they welcome a child. Why? Let's dissect it:

  • Clinical Fertility Treatments: Each IVF cycle can cost upwards of €4,000 to €6,000, with multiple cycles often required.
  • Diagnostic Tests and Consultations: Essential but pricey, these add thousands more.
  • Medications: Hormonal drugs to stimulate ovulation can run into thousands.
  • Travel and Time Off Work: Many must take unpaid leave or incur additional costs traveling to specialized clinics.

All told, the financial strain is crushing, forcing sacrifices in other life areas—as our featured woman did by budgeting just €40 a week on essentials.

Understanding the Costs Behind Donor Sperm

Donor sperm is priced not just for the biological material but also for the comprehensive screening, legal safeguards, and clinic overheads that come with it. Especially when opting for an anonymous donor, clinics invest considerable resources to ensure safety and anonymity compliance, which drives up prices.

For single women, these expenses add a substantial layer to the already demanding financial landscape of fertility treatments. Beyond that, fertility clinics often mandate insemination within clinical settings, which brings additional consultation and procedural fees.

What To Consider If You’re Thinking About Solo Motherhood

Becoming a single mum by choice requires thoughtful planning beyond the emotional readiness:

  1. Choose Your Donor Wisely: Whether known or anonymous, the donor’s health, personality, and legal status matter deeply.
  2. Understand Legalities: Laws around donor conception vary widely. Get informed to protect your and your child’s rights.
  3. Budget Realistically: Account for sperm costs, insemination supplies, and any ancillary medical advice or support.
  4. Look Into Support Networks: Solo parenting comes with challenges; community support and counseling can be invaluable.
